Course Content

• Introduction to Smart Manufacturing and Quality Control
• Risk Assessment and Mitigation Strategies in Smart Manufacturing
• Quality Management Systems (QMS) for Smart Factories (including ISO 9001)
• Data Analytics and Statistical Process Control (SPC) for Quality Improvement
• Implementing and Monitoring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) in Smart Manufacturing
• Cybersecurity and Data Integrity in Smart Manufacturing Quality Control
• Predictive Maintenance and its Role in Risk Mitigation
• Human Factors and Ergonomics in Smart Manufacturing Quality Control
• Supply Chain Risk Management in a Smart Manufacturing Environment
• Case Studies: Quality Control Risk Mitigation in Real-World Smart Factories

Career path

Career Role Description
Quality Control Engineer (Smart Manufacturing) Implementing and maintaining quality control systems in smart factories, focusing on risk mitigation and process optimization. High demand for automation and data analysis skills.
Risk Mitigation Specialist (Smart Manufacturing) Identifying and assessing risks within smart manufacturing processes. Developing and implementing strategies to mitigate potential disruptions and ensure operational efficiency.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ills are crucial.
Data Analyst - Quality Control (Smart Manufacturing) Analyzing large datasets from smart manufacturing systems to identify quality control issues, trends, and areas for improvement. Proficiency in statistical analysis and data visualization tools is essential.
Smart Manufacturing Process Engineer Designing, implementing, and optimizing smart manufacturing processes, with a strong focus on quality control and risk mitigation throughout the entire lifecycle. Expertise in lean manufacturing principles and automation technologies is highly valued.
